| I know it is -current and probably not everything is meant to work smoothly and I am also aware that this damn firmware is not supported by OpenBSD devs. Here are the facts though. I am running the latest snapshot and I have installed v3.0 of the required proprietary firmware. When I do ifconfig -M iwi0 I get this: iwi0: timeout waiting for firmware initialization to complete iwi0: could not load boot firmware iwi0: timeout waiting for firmware initialization to complete iwi0: could not load boot firmware Keep in mind that v2.3 works well under OpenBSD -stable. So, if you are planning to join -current any time soon I can verify that your wireless card is not going to work. |
